JHB cermet coated housings (pics)








This 12a housings seem to be from a 79 or 80 engine right? Mine is 81 and Im not familiar with these. I know I should plug the holes for gas recirculation, but... should I remove the sleeve? Im not sure how to port these.

It also got the half moon on the spark plugs... I will have to grind that down

Any input is welcome

Shrouded spark plug holes and lack of thermal reactor ports in the exhaust housing suggest its a later model, 83-85 IIRC.

Are you planning on porting them? Only remove the sleeve if your going for a really aggressive porting (race only).
